There is this talk by Harsha Bhogle which i had watched in 2007 (ya, that youtube video i linked is from 2014, but this talk was delivered in ~2005) which had pretty big impact on me. He talks about excellence a lot in that talk. One of thing which remained with me was this part of the speech
A lot of us place a lot of emphasis on talent, don’t we? I mean we often look at someone who’s talented and say wow. Talent does that to people, it dazzles you. And yet you find that excellence is not about talent alone, in fact, a major part of excellence has nothing to do with talent. And in course of time, once you go beyond a certain level, ability or talent is the most useless virtue to possess. It’s what you do with the talent that matters. Beyond a point, it is an attitude that counts for far more than talent because talent breeds any ego and talent never solve problems beyond a point
Harsha bhogle extends that point beautifully with examples from sports world. I agree with that line of thought and i want to write down couple of fundamental things which are essential for excellence other than talent.
Curiosity and Routine.
When i look at my kids, I realize how extremely curious kids are and consequently their rate of learning is extremely high. I feel curiosity just goes down as we age. The trick is to remain curious in fields where we want to excel. That will drive initiatives and enables to learn more things. It is very easy to get confused between wanting to do something and curiosity. Wanting to do something is more of a wish list which we maintain a distance with usually, but curiosity ensures you take the first step in what you want to do.
And the other fundamental thing helps to excel is Routine. It feels like a basic thing, but routine makes sure we show up. Starting point of the excellence many times just starts with showing up everyday and keep doing things. It is easy to get distracted for the shiny new thing or not having motivation to show up after a hard day – but once we start showing up no matter what, magic starts to happen.
